A career as a Plastics Research and Development Scientist offers an exciting opportunity to innovate in the field of materials science, specifically focusing on the development and improvement of plastic materials used in various applications. To embark on this career path, individuals typically need a strong academic foundation in polymer science, chemistry, or materials engineering. A bachelor's degree is essential, followed by potential specialization through master's or doctoral programs. Gaining practical experience through internships, research projects, or working in laboratories enhances employability. Networking with professionals in the field and staying updated with the latest advancements in polymer technology are also crucial. With a blend of education, experience, and passion for materials science, one can build a rewarding career dedicated to advancing plastics technology.
